From c269b442edf11cb7611d179d23bc5cd7da5c8908 Mon Sep 17 00:00:00 2001 From: Alexandre Date: Sun, 7 Jan 2024 19:56:56 +0100 Subject: [PATCH] use abs path instead of rel --- main.go | 7 +++---- 1 file changed, 3 insertions(+), 4 deletions(-) diff --git a/main.go b/main.go index dc61d15..700014d 100644 --- a/main.go +++ b/main.go @@ -59,6 +59,7 @@ func (w *IpfsMultipartWriter) CreateIpfsAbsFilePart(name, absPath string) (io.Wr h.Set("Content-Type", "application/octet-stream") return w.CreatePart(h) } + func main() { githubactions.Infof("Checking inputs...") @@ -119,15 +120,13 @@ func main() { return err } - relPath, _ := filepath.Rel(path, innerPath) - if info.IsDir() { - _, err = mwriter.CreateIpfsDirectoryPart(relPath) + _, err = mwriter.CreateIpfsDirectoryPart(innerPath) if err != nil { return err } } else { - w, err := mwriter.CreateIpfsFilePart(relPath) + w, err := mwriter.CreateIpfsFilePart(innerPath) if err != nil { return err }